- /// A CLI argument definition
- #[skip_serializing_none]
- #[derive(Debug, PartialEq, Clone, Deserialize, Serialize, JsonSchema)]
- #[serde(rename_all = "camelCase", deny_unknown_fields)]
- pub struct CliArg {
- /// The short version of the argument, without the preceding -.
- ///
- /// NOTE: Any leading - characters will be stripped, and only the first non - character will be used as the short version.
- pub short: Option<char>,
- /// The unique argument name
- pub name: String,
- /// The argument description which will be shown on the help information.
- /// Typically, this is a short (one line) description of the arg.
- pub description: Option<String>,
- /// The argument long description which will be shown on the help information.
- /// Typically this a more detailed (multi-line) message that describes the argument.
- pub long_description: Option<String>,
- /// Specifies that the argument takes a value at run time.
- ///
- /// NOTE: values for arguments may be specified in any of the following methods
- /// - Using a space such as -o value or --option value
- /// - Using an equals and no space such as -o=value or --option=value
- /// - Use a short and no space such as -ovalue
- pub takes_value: Option<bool>,
- /// Specifies that the argument may appear more than once.
- ///
- /// - For flags, this results in the number of occurrences of the flag being recorded.
- /// For example -ddd or -d -d -d would count as three occurrences.
- /// - For options there is a distinct difference in multiple occurrences vs multiple values.
- /// For example, --opt val1 val2 is one occurrence, but two values. Whereas --opt val1 --opt val2 is two occurrences.
- pub multiple: Option<bool>,
- /// specifies that the argument may appear more than once.
- pub multiple_occurrences: Option<bool>,
- ///
- pub number_of_values: Option<u64>,
- /// Specifies a list of possible values for this argument.
- /// At runtime, the CLI verifies that only one of the specified values was used, or fails with an error message.
- pub possible_values: Option<Vec<String>>,
- /// Specifies the minimum number of values for this argument.
- /// For example, if you had a -f <file> argument where you wanted at least 2 'files',
- /// you would set `minValues: 2`, and this argument would be satisfied if the user provided, 2 or more values.
- pub min_values: Option<u64>,
- /// Specifies the maximum number of values are for this argument.
- /// For example, if you had a -f <file> argument where you wanted up to 3 'files',
- /// you would set .max_values(3), and this argument would be satisfied if the user provided, 1, 2, or 3 values.
- pub max_values: Option<u64>,
- /// Sets whether or not the argument is required by default.
- ///
- /// - Required by default means it is required, when no other conflicting rules have been evaluated
- /// - Conflicting rules take precedence over being required.
- pub required: Option<bool>,
- /// Sets an arg that override this arg's required setting
- /// i.e. this arg will be required unless this other argument is present.
- pub required_unless_present: Option<String>,
- /// Sets args that override this arg's required setting
- /// i.e. this arg will be required unless all these other arguments are present.
- pub required_unless_present_all: Option<Vec<String>>,
- /// Sets args that override this arg's required setting
- /// i.e. this arg will be required unless at least one of these other arguments are present.
- pub required_unless_present_any: Option<Vec<String>>,
- /// Sets a conflicting argument by name
- /// i.e. when using this argument, the following argument can't be present and vice versa.
- pub conflicts_with: Option<String>,
- /// The same as conflictsWith but allows specifying multiple two-way conflicts per argument.
- pub conflicts_with_all: Option<Vec<String>>,
- /// Tets an argument by name that is required when this one is present
- /// i.e. when using this argument, the following argument must be present.
- pub requires: Option<String>,
- /// Sts multiple arguments by names that are required when this one is present
- /// i.e. when using this argument, the following arguments must be present.
- pub requires_all: Option<Vec<String>>,
- /// Allows a conditional requirement with the signature [arg, value]
- /// the requirement will only become valid if `arg`'s value equals `${value}`.
- pub requires_if: Option<Vec<String>>,
- /// Allows specifying that an argument is required conditionally with the signature [arg, value]
- /// the requirement will only become valid if the `arg`'s value equals `${value}`.
- pub required_if_eq: Option<Vec<String>>,
- /// Requires that options use the --option=val syntax
- /// i.e. an equals between the option and associated value.
- pub require_equals: Option<bool>,
- /// The positional argument index, starting at 1.
- ///
- /// The index refers to position according to other positional argument.
- /// It does not define position in the argument list as a whole. When utilized with multiple=true,
- /// only the last positional argument may be defined as multiple (i.e. the one with the highest index).
- pub index: Option<u64>,
- }
